What Does a FHA Loan Specialist in Pittston Cost?

Typical costs for an FHA loan in Pennsylvania include an upfront mortgage insurance premium of 1.75 percent of the loan amount and an annual premium of 0.55 percent to 0.85 percent. Closing costs generally range from 2 to 5 percent of the purchase price. Lender fees for origination and processing vary by institution. Frequently Asked Questions

What does an FHA loan specialist in Pittston do?
An FHA loan specialist helps you determine if you qualify for an FHA loan, explains the required mortgage insurance premiums, and assists with the application process. They also review your credit score, debt-to-income ratio, and employment history to ensure you meet FHA guidelines.
What are the FHA loan limits for Pittston Pennsylvania?
For 2025, the FHA loan limit for a single-family home in Luzerne County is $498,257. This limit applies to standard FHA loans and may be higher for multi-unit properties. Your specialist can confirm the current limits based on your specific property type.
How long does the FHA loan process take in Pennsylvania?
The typical FHA loan process in Pennsylvania takes 30 to 45 days from application to closing. This timeline includes the appraisal, underwriting, and final approval. Delays can occur if additional documentation is needed or if the property requires repairs.
